1. The Contractor Is responsible f or preparing and Implementing
a Storm Water Pollution Prevention Plan (SWP3) In accordance
with TCEQ Texas Pollutant Discharge Elimination System (TPDES)
Permit No. TXR150000 (PERMIT). The details shown on this sheet
represent -typical methods f or controlling erosion during
construction and are Intended f or tne Contractors guidance In
preparing his Pollution Prevention Plan. The Contractors plan shall
comply with the PERMIT and Federal, State and local requirements.
The Contractors plan shall Include, but not be limited to, preparation
and submittal of a Notice of Intent (NOI) to the TCEQ, If the project
Is 5 acres or larger and preparation of oil plans arid documentation
as required by the PERMIT.
2. It Is the intent of the Inf ormatlon provided on these
documents to be used as a general guideline for the Contractor.
The SWP3 to be prepared by the Contractor shallmeet the current
requirements set f orth In the TCEQ's TPDES general permit f or
storm water discharges from construction sites as well as any
local requirements.
3. The Contractor shall be responsible f or maintaining erosion
control during construction and f or obtaining any required
construction related drainage permits, or making any construction
related notif Icatlons. An Inspection report that summarizes
Inspection activities and Implementation of the SWP3 shall be
performed as required by the PERMIT and retained by the
Contractor and made a part of the construction documents. The
Contractor shall provide copies of all SWP3 documents Including, but
not limited to, Inspection records, original plans, and modified
plans to the Owner at contract close-out. During construction the
contractor shall provide copies of the Inspection reports to the
Owner on a monthly basis.
4. Temporary storm drainage and/or erosion control material
shall be suitable f or this application and shall be Installed
with the proper techniques by the Contractor as required by
NCTCOG Standard Speclf Icof Ions f or Public Works Construction.
Temporary storm drainage and/or erosion control material shall
be removed by the Contractor, in addition to any excavations
backf Tiled by the Contractor, In accordance with NCTCOG
Standard Specif Ications f or Public Works Construction when
temporary erosion control devices are no longer needed as
speclf led In the PERMIT. Maintenance of the permanent
erosion control measures at the site will be assumed by the
Owner at contract close out and acceptance of the work.
5. The Contractor shall maintain his SWP3 in accordance with
the TCEQ Permit and make his SWP3 available, upon request, to
the TCEO and/or Owner.
6. The Contractor must amend his SWP3 whenever there Is a
change In design, construction, operation, or maintenance of
the SWP3, or when the existing SWP3 proves Inef f ective.
Modif Icaf Tons shall not compromise the Intent of the
requirements of the PERMIT. Modif IcatTons Including design and
alladditTonalmaterials and work shallbe accomplished by the
Contrac-i-or, ot I'lo, add] 1-. Tonal explanse to the
1. The Contractor shallInspect his stabilization and erosion
control measures at a minimum of once every 14 days, and within
24 hours of ter any storm event greater than 0.5 Inches, or once
every 7 days. The Contractor shallrepaIr Inadequacies revealed
by the Inspection before the next storm event and he shall
modify his SWP3 within 7 days of the Inspection.
8. The Contractor sholladopt and Implement approprlote
construction site management practices to prevent the discharge
of oils, grease, points, gasoline, and other pollutants to storm
water. Appropriate practices shall Include, but not be limited
to.- designating areas for equipment maintenance and repair;
collecting wastes periodically; maintaining conveniently located
waste receptacles, and designating and controlling equipment
washdown.
9. Borrow areas, If excavated, shall be protected and
stabilized by the Contractor In a manner acceptable to the
Owner and In accordance with PERMIT requirements.
10. AlInon-poved areas shallbe seeded and mulched with
erosion protection gross by the Contractor Immediately upon
completion of fTnalgradlng. This Includes alldTtches and
embankments. The Contractor shallmaintaTril finalgrading,
and keep seeded areas watered untlifully established and
accepted by Owner.
11. The Contractor shollconstruct a silt fence at locations
suggested on plans as appropriate or as modified In his SWP3 to
f It site conditions at the time of plooement, and all borrow and
stock pile areas. The silt f ence shall be constructed as, detailed
on this plan. The Contractor shall remove accumulated silt when It
reaches a depth of 1/3 the height of the silt f ence. The
Contractor shall dispose of the removed silt In a location
approved by the Owner and In such a manner as to not
contribute to erosion and sedimentation. The Contractor shall
remove the silt fence when the site Is completely stabilized
In accordance with the PERMIT.
12. The Contractor shoildesIgnate materialand equipment
storage areas mutually agreed to by the Owner. The storage
areas shall be graded for positive drainage, and the surf are
stabilized with a minimum of 2 Inches of compacted flex base
on 6 Inches of scarifled and recompacfed subgrade by the
Contractor. A silt fence shollbe Installed by the Contractor
around the storage areas to prevent eroded materlalfrom
leaving the site.
13. All Inlets (onsite and of f site) receiving drainage water
from disturbed areas shall be protected by the Contractor as per
details shown or other Owner approved methods to prevent eroded.
material from being transported Into Inlets. The Inlet protection
shall be constructed as shown on these plans.
14. The notes and details contained herin do not relieve the
Contractor and Owner of meeting and implementing the
requirements of the PERMIT.

1, Existing utilities shown are taken from available records provided by the utility Owner and field
locations of surface appurtenances. Locations shown are generally schematic in nature and may not
accurately reflect the size and location of each particular utility. Some utility lines may not be shown.
Contractor shall assume responsibility for actual field location and protection of existing facilities
whether shown or not. Contractor shall also assume responsibility for repairs to existing facilities,
whether shown or not, damaged by Contractor's activities. Differences in horizontal or vertical location
of existing utilities shall not be a basis for additional expense.
2. Pavement removal and repair shall conform to City of Grapevine requirements. All sawcuts shall
be full depth Guts. Contractor shall make efforts to protect concrete and/or asphalt edges. Any large
spalled or broken edges shall be removed by sawcutting pavement prior to replacement.
3. Contractor shall maintain positive drainage at all time during construction. Ponding of water in
streets, drives, truck courts, trenches, etc. will not be allowed.
4. Contractor shall locate and adjust existing utility manhole lids, cleanouts, water valves and other
surface appurtenances as required for new construction. Contractor shall coordinate utility
adjustments with other disciplines and the appropriate utility agencies and provide for all fees for
permits, connections, inspections, etc.
5. Contractor's work shall include pavement removal and disposal required for new walk, drive, curb,
gutter and other paving features. Contractor shall be responsible for all coordination, inspection and
testing required by_the Owner and/or the City of Grapevine.
6. Concrete paving joints shall be constructed as noted below. Expansion joints shall be placed at
changes in direction of paving, at driveways and/or as shown on the drawings. Seal all joints as shown
on the drawings.
7. Paving sections shall be sawcut in 15 -foot squares.
8. All dimensions are to face of curb or face of building. These dimensions are provided to tie the
Architect's Site Plan to the property lines.
9� Barricading and traffic control during construction shall be the responsibility of the Contractor and
shall conform to the "Texas Manual on Uniform Traffic Control Devices", Part VI in particular. Traffic
flow and access shall be maintained during all phases of the construction, The Contractor is
responsible for providing traffic safety measures for work on project.
10. The Contractor shall protect existing property monumentation and primary control. Any such
points which the Contractor believes will be destroyed shall have offset points established by the
Contractor prior to construction. Any monumentation destroyed by the Contractor shall be
reestablished at his expense.
11. It shall be the responsibility of the Contractor to: A. Prevent any damage to private property and
property owner's poles, fences, shrubs, etc. B. Provide access to all drives during construction. C.
Protect all underground utilities to remain in service. D. Notify all utility companies and verify location of
all utilities prior to start of construction.
12. Any damages that may occur to real property or existing improvements shall be restored by the
Contractor to at least the same condition that the real property or existing improvements were in prior
to the damagies� 'his. -res, ation shall be subject to the Owner's approval; moreover, this restoration
�shal[,nrott6 a bas's for additional compensation to the Contractor. Restoration shall include, but not be
limi e06jegrasshg, revegetation, replacing fences, replacing trees, etc.
13. All sidewalks shall maintain 2% cross slope maximum.
14. Slopes along sidewalks in the direction of trav--i shall not exceed 5%.
15, Slopes within designated handicap areas shall not exceed 2% in any direction.
16. See architect and structural plans for additional dimensions and details.
